/// <summary>
        /// Calls the server to get updated status of the long-running operation.
        /// </summary>
        /// <param name="async">When <c>true</c>, the method will be executed asynchronously; otherwise, it will execute synchronously.</param>
        /// <param name="cancellationToken">A <see cref="CancellationToken"/> used for the service call.</param>
        /// <returns>The HTTP response received from the server.</returns>
        private async ValueTask <Response> UpdateStatusAsync(bool async, CancellationToken cancellationToken)
        {
            if (!_hasCompleted)
            {
                Response <AnalyzeOperationResult_internal> update = async
                    ? await _serviceClient.GetAnalyzeReceiptResultAsync(new Guid(Id), cancellationToken).ConfigureAwait(false)
                    : _serviceClient.GetAnalyzeReceiptResult(new Guid(Id), cancellationToken);

                _response = update.GetRawResponse();

                if (update.Value.Status == OperationStatus.Succeeded)
                {
                    // We need to first assign a value and then mark the operation as completed to avoid a race condition with the getter in Value
                    _value        = ConvertToRecognizedReceipts(update.Value.AnalyzeResult);
                    _hasCompleted = true;
                }
                else if (update.Value.Status == OperationStatus.Failed)
                {
                    _requestFailedException = await ClientCommon
                                              .CreateExceptionForFailedOperationAsync(async, _diagnostics, _response, update.Value.AnalyzeResult.Errors)
                                              .ConfigureAwait(false);

                    _hasCompleted = true;
                    throw _requestFailedException;
                }
            }

            return(GetRawResponse());
        }
